PFFC - July 2008 - (Page 4) FIRST GLANCE Bon Voyage Diamond Packaging, Rochester, NY, wins a Gold Leaf award from the Foil Stamping & Embossing Assn. for Coty’s new Nautica My Voyage For Her packaging. The reverse tuck cartons feature a 0.018 SBS holographic foilboard. Graphics were achieved by offset printing UV black, UV white, and one PMS color in-line with a UV gloss coating over the holographic portion of the carton. A dull stampable varnish was used on the carton’s lower white portion. Overprinting the holographic foil with transparent blue ink creates a stunning visual effect said to capture the essense of ocean waves and warm summer breezes. The Nautica logo was stamped with pink foil, connecting the product to the prestigious brand. Blue and pink foil-stamped accents add further detail. The bottom portion of the carton was stamped with opaque white foil and embossed with a crosshatch pattern, imparting a unique tactile and visual effect, reminiscent of sandy white beaches. Hot Without Hot Stamping Great Western Industries, Dallas, TX, earns Gold Awards from the Paperboard Packaging Council for The Devil Wears Prada DVD sleeve because it delivers the eye-catching impact of a hologram without using hot-stamped holographic foil. The package has to project the look of a patent-leather shoe. The converter uses a cast-andcure printing process that follows customary four-color printing plus a UV coating. An additional pass lays down a pliable primer. The primed sheet runs under an embossing film followed by an immediate curing process. The shrink label covers a custom-molded PP cup thermoformed at Printpack’s Williamsburg, VA, facility. The 2-mil PVC label is rotogravure printed in eight colors and includes a special adhesive that is applied during printing so the label will adhere to the curves of the microwavable container. The label provides a large billboard for ConAgra to show off the product as well as add nutrition facts, ingredients, UPC code, and heating instructions. Did you produce a cool converted product?
